Kahlua Cake Recipe

For the Cake:
¾ cup salted butter, softened, plus more for greasing the pan
2 cups granulated sugar
¾ cup cocoa, preferably Ghirardelli's or Valrhona
4 eggs, separated
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 tablespoons cold water
½ cup cold coffee
½ cup Kahlua
1¾ cups cake flour, plus more for dusting the pan
1 tablespoon vanilla extract

For the Glaze:
1 cup Kahlua
½ cup powdered sugar
Fresh Whipped Cream, (see recipe), for garnish
Fresh Strawberries, sliced, for garnish

Directions:
Directions:
1). Preheat the oven to 325 degrees. For the cake, in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ment on medium high speed, cream the butter and sugar until light and fluffy, about 2 to 3 minutes. Add the cocoa and mix until combined. With the mixer running on medium speed, add the egg yolks one at a time, mixing for one minute between each addition. Stir in the vanilla.

2). Dissolve the baking soda in the water. Combine the soda and water mixture with the coffee and Kahlua. With the mixer on low, add the flour and the Kahlua mixture alternately in 3 batches, beginning and ending with the flour. Mix just until combined after each addition.

3). Remove the cake batter to a large bowl. Wash, clean and dry the mixing bowl. Fit the mixer with the whisk attachment and add the egg whites, mix on high speed until stiff peaks form. Gently fold the egg whites into the cake batter.

4). Grease a 10-inch Bundt pan with softened butter. Dust the pan with flour shaking off any excess. Pour the batter into the prepared pan. Bake for 45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ean. Allow the cake to c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then turn out onto a wire rack.

5). For the glaze, pierce the top of the cake with a fork. Combine the Kahlua and powdered sugar and whisk until smooth. Pour the glaze over the warm cake. When ready to serve, make the Fresh Whipped Cream according to the instructions. Serve the cake with a dollop of cream and sliced strawberries.
